Who is Linda Štucbartová

Linda Štucbartová is a member of the Executive Board of the Czech-Israeli Mixed Chamber, where she leads the Science, Research, and Innovation section. Her latest project is spreading the unique concept of Self-defense for everyone, for which she received the Heart of the Year award from the City of Prague 2022, was nominated for Woman of the Year 2022, and reached the semifinals of the SDGs awards by the Association of Social Responsibility. This year, she is nominated for the Diversity Role Model award in the CEE region.
She is also involved in activities at Diversio, a company connecting the commercial and academic sectors. She has implemented projects such as Women in Tech and, together with the Neuron Foundation, programs for young scientists in Israel. In her practice, she has worked with over a thousand leaders from the CEE region in long-term transformation programs. She serves on the Commercialization Council of Charles University and is an evaluator for the Technology Agency. Her passion is writing; she authored the book Ambassadors without a diplomatic passport and over 300 interviews with leading personalities for Czech and Slovak Leaders Magazine.
